Which is better for HS in terms of wait times and crowds - starting around Noon on a Friday or going at rope drop on a Sunday?
I always like to do rope drop but I’m trying to plan my days for next December. I can either put HS on the day after (hopefully) the Christmas Party or on a Sunday. I know I don’t know the schedule for Christmas Parties but historically they’ve had a Thursday Party. TIA
 
Will you get G+?

If so, you can take advantage of stacking return times and do afternoon.

If not, it can be either way. HS wait times seem to build quickly early and are much shorter by the end of the night. So you can Rope Drop and get a few rides in with a short wait and then face long waits for the late morning/afternoon OR arrive with some longer wait times and then they will hopefully get shorter.
 
If you're purchasing Genie+ we had great success stacking ILL$ rides at DHS and arriving in the afternoon.

We were able to ride SDD, TSM, ToT and ST using G+. Could have added Muppets or something too but we didn't need Genie+ for what was being offered.

If you want to ride RotR and not pay for ILL$, another great option is to wait and get in line just before park close. We did that. Line said 80 mins and we were off in 40 mins. The risk with that is RotR not running at the end of the day which also happened to us once that trip.
